From 9bd2057237d342b7ab7d4eb0e453a7e90e156533 Mon Sep 17 00:00:00 2001 From: Anuken Date: Tue, 8 Dec 2020 14:07:18 -0500 Subject: [PATCH] Fixed #3871 --- desktop/src/mindustry/desktop/steam/SStats.java | 12 +++++++----- 1 file changed, 7 insertions(+), 5 deletions(-) diff --git a/desktop/src/mindustry/desktop/steam/SStats.java b/desktop/src/mindustry/desktop/steam/SStats.java index fc5f01cbef..5471e4310d 100644 --- a/desktop/src/mindustry/desktop/steam/SStats.java +++ b/desktop/src/mindustry/desktop/steam/SStats.java @@ -301,12 +301,14 @@ public class SStats implements SteamUserStatsCallback{ }); Events.on(SectorCaptureEvent.class, e -> { - if(Vars.state.wave <= 5 && state.rules.attackMode){ - defeatAttack5Waves.complete(); - } + if(e.sector.isBeingPlayed() || net.client()){ + if(Vars.state.wave <= 5 && state.rules.attackMode){ + defeatAttack5Waves.complete(); + } - if(state.stats.buildingsDestroyed == 0){ - captureNoBlocksBroken.complete(); + if(state.stats.buildingsDestroyed == 0){ + captureNoBlocksBroken.complete(); + } } if(Vars.state.rules.attackMode){